Lasseters Landing is ideally located for day trips to lighthouses, historical sites, museums, aquarium, planetarium, estuary or any of the numerous local preserves and wildlife refuges. The 10 thousand acre Palmetto Peartree Preserve, home to the endangered Red-Cockaded Woodpecker, is just 4 miles from our front door. In addition to the beautiful Scuppernong River, Tyrrell County is bordered on the north by the Albemarle Sound (one of the East Coast's largest estuarine systems), and to the east by the Alligator River (which is part of the Atlantic coast Intracoastal Waterway System). It goes without saying that water born activities are a major part of Columbia and Tyrrell County's heritage and present day way of life. Our area waterways provide opportunities for sailing, fishing, paddling, hunting, bird watching and many other recreational activities. "Dear Greg and Betty - it's been very nice meeting you.
